President Donald Trump is expected to speak with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man on Thursday, according to reports. The call would be the latest in a series of direct communications between the two leaders. As The Zioneer has reported, they spoke on August 2, when bin Salman urged Trump to halt a planned U.S. military strike on Iran, and the Saudi state news agency SPA confirmed the two leaders discussed de-escalation. The ongoing dialogue reflects Riyadh's role as a key intermediary between Washington and Tehran amid the current crisis.
